15V209000 · Equipment:Recreational Vehicle/Trailer

Reported: 2015-04-07 (April 7, 2015) · Model years: 2015, 2016

Highland Ridge RV (Highland) is recalling certain model year 2015-2016 Roamer, Mesa Ridge, Light, 3X, and Journeyer travel and fifth wheel trailers manufactured March 6, 2015, to March 26, 2015. In the affected vehicles, the screws that attach the expanding room to the sliding mechanism cable may fail allowing the room to extend unintentionally while the vehicle is in motion.

Consequence: If the room extends while vehicle is in motion, there is an increased risk of a crash.

Remedy: Highland will notify owners, and dealers will replace the slide room mechanism attaching screws, free of charge. The recall began on May 5, 2015. Owners may contact Highland customer service at 1-260-768-7771.

15V304000 · Equipment:Recreational Vehicle/Trailer

Reported: 2015-05-22 (May 22, 2015) · Model years: 2015

Highland Ridge RV (Highland Ridge) is recalling certain model year 2015 Roamer, Mesa Ridge and 3X fifth wheel trailers manufactured May 7, 2014, to June 4, 2014. In the affected vehicles, a rivet for the quad entry steps may shear and fail, causing the steps to give when being used.

Consequence: If the rivet shears under occupant load, the steps may give and the occupant may fall, increasing the risk of personal injury.

Remedy: Highland Ridge will notify owners, and dealers will remove the rivets and the step sections will be bolted together, free of charge. The recall began during June 2015. Owners may contact Highland Ridge customer service at 1-260-768-7771. Highland Ridge's number for this recall is 9904242.

16V058000 · Equipment:Recreational Vehicle/Trailer

Reported: 2016-02-02 (February 2, 2016) · Model years: 2015, 2016

Highland Ridge RV (Highland) is recalling certain model year 2015-2016 Highlander, Mesa Ridge, Roamer, and Journeyer travel trailers manufactured April 7, 2014, to January 11, 2016. The affected vehicles are equipped with safety chains on the A-frame that are rated for 11,700lb instead of being rated equal to or greater than the g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) of the travel trailer.

Consequence: In the event the main trailer connection fails, the weight of the trailer can break the safety chains if the chains are not strong enough, allowing the trailer to separate from the vehicle,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y: Highland will notify owners, and dealers will replace the existing safety chains with chains that have a 16,200lb rating, free of charge. The recall began on February 25, 2016. Owners may contact Highland customer service at 1-260-768-7771. Highland's number for this recall is 9904277.

16V092000 · Equipment:Other:Labels

Reported: 2016-02-18 (February 18, 2016) · Model years: 2015, 2016

Highland Ridge RV (Highland) is recalling certain model year 2015-2016 Highland Toy Hauler, Light, Mesa Ridge, and Roamer travel and fifth wheel trailers manufactured May 6, 2014, to August 31, 2015. The Gross Vehicle Weight Rating calculation on the label may be incorrect, which can allow the vehicle to be overloaded.

Consequence: If the vehicle is overloaded due to incorrect Weight Rating information on the label, tire failure may result,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y: Highland will notify owners and will provide a corrected label, free of charge. One model, the HT31RGR Highland Toy Hauler will require two heavier axles installed and five larger tires as well. These repairs will provided free of charge. The recall began on March 22, 2016. Owners may contact Highland customer service at 1-260-768-7771. Highland's number for this recall is 9904283.

15V238000 · Suspension:Rear:Axle:Non-Powered Axle Assembly

Reported: 2015-04-21 (April 21, 2015) · Model years: 2016

Highland Ridge RV (Highland) is recalling certain model year 2016 Mesa Ridge, 3X, and Roamer travel trailers and fifth wheels, models 367FB, 388RKS, and 427BHS, manufactured from April 27, 2015, to May 6, 2015. In the affected trailers, the studs that are used to attach the wheels to the axle hubs may break.

Consequence: If the wheel studs break, the wheel could detach from the vehicle,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y: Highland will notify owners, and dealers will replace any affected wheel hub, free of charge. The recall began on June 16, 2015. Owners may contact Highland customer service at 1-260-768-7771. Highland's numbers for this recall are 9904237 and 9904238.

17V037000 · Equipment:Recreational Vehicle/Trailer

Reported: 2017-01-17 (January 17, 2017) · Model years: 2017

Highland Ridge RV (Highland) is recalling certain 2017 Open Range, Mesa Ridge and Roamer fifth wheels and travel trailers. These vehicles are equipped with an outside range that can be stored with the gas valve left open, allowing gas to enter and buildup within the vehicle.

Consequence: If gas leaks into the cabin, it can increase the risk of an explosion or fire.

Remedy: Highland Ridge will notify owners and dealers will install a larger gas valve handle, inspect that the drawer guide rail is in its proper location, repairing it as required, and place a warning label on the range stating the gas valve must be turned off prior to storing the range in the unit. The recall began on March 8, 2017. Owners may contact Highland customer service at 1-260-768-7771. Highland's number for this recall is 9904341.

17V288000 · Interior Lighting

Reported: 2017-05-01 (May 1, 2017) · Model years: 2017

Highland Ridge RV (Highland Ridge) is recalling certain 2017 Open Range, Highlander, Light and Roamer and Mesa Ridge fifth wheels and Mesa Ridge, Light, Roamer and Ultra Lite travel trailers. The LED ceiling lights may produce excessive heat.

Consequence: The excessive heat from the LED ceiling lights may increase the risk of a fire.

Remedy: Highland Ridge will notify owners, and dealers will replace the affected LED ceiling lights with a different light, free of charge. The recall began on May 23, 2017. Owners may contact Highland Ridge customer service at 1-260-768-7771. Highland Ridge's number for this recall is 9904350.
